Quality and Safety/Security Certification Manager
Cornerstone Concilium, Inc. is seeking a Quality and Safety/Security Certification Manager to support the development of a QA/QC Program Plan and ensure compliance with quality standards. The role involves managing quality meetings, conducting audits, and providing recommendations to resolve quality-related issues throughout various phases of projects.

Responsibilities
Support development of a program-specific QA/QC Program Plan with representatives from the WMATA Office of Quality and Internal Compliance Operations (QICO)
Establish key quality indices for all aspects of the designated programs; · Issue non-conformance notices to contractors on incorrect construction methods or materials found during audit, inspection, or surveillance
Maintain and monitor the performance of the program against KPI’s established for QA/QC
Program Plan and provide weekly reports to the PM
Manage Quality Meetings with engaging technical stakeholders, engineers, designers, and subcontractors to review program requirements and clarify and resolve any quality & SSC (Safety & Security Certification) questions or problems in every phase of the projects
Review construction materials based on conformance with specifications
Work constructively with members of the program team to resolve program quality-related issues and provide recommendations to the project team
Conduct audits of manufacturers, suppliers, installation contractors, systems integration, and acceptance testing
Review quality program submittals for compliance, as required by contract documents; and
Assist the Task Manager with closeout of the construction contracts to affirm all quality measures were achieved in the construction of the work
Review contractors’ daily reports, and Observations and flag any document and quality related issues
Assist Task Manager and other project’s key personnel with the review of safety and security certification plan (SSCO), Certifiable Items List (CIL), Project Hazard Analysis (PHA)
Manage Safety & Security Working Group (SCWG) and monitor the SSC process
Provide Task Manager with monthly quality report

Qualification
Required
A minimum of a bachelor's degree in engineering, quality, architecture, or related field
A minimum of ten (10) years quality assurance and/or quality control experience in construction engineering and related quality oversight of inspection and testing for large infrastructure projects
Familiarity with ISO 9000 quality standards and its application to planning, design, and construction
A minimum of five (5) years of experience conducting quality assurance audits and surveillance of engineering design and construction activities
Familiarity with WMATA design criteria and standards and Quality Management Manual
Safety & Security Certification Program Representative shall have, within the last 3 years, completed a recognized certification training course provided by Federal Transportation Administration (FTA), Transportation Safety Institute (TSI), or other recognized Safety and Security Certification Training Agency
Proficiency with Microsoft 365® Suite
Preferred
Certified Manager of Quality/Organizational Excellence (CMQ/OE) Certification or Certified Quality Engineer (CQE) Certification
